Status—Alarms
This window represents a software panel of monitored conditions in the OM.
Although not applicable to all alarm conditions, the six status levels are OK (green),
Indeterminate (gray), Warning (yellow), Minor alarm (blue), Major alarm (magenta),
and Critical alarm (red). Warning, Minor, and Major alarms do not prevent the OM
from performing operational requirements. A Critical alarm prevents the OM from
performing operational requirements. The Status—Alarms window is illustrated in
Figure 4-20 and defined in Table 4-7 .
